There is no direct connection from Thamesmead to Colindale. However, you can take the train to Liverpool Street Station, walk to Moorgate station, then take the subway to Colindale station.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Thamesmead / Carlyle Road to Colindale station via Greenwich Station, Greenwich DLR Station, Bank DLR Station, and Bank station in around 2h.
